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All
Print Page as PDF
Routine: BPSOSQA

Package: E Claims Management Engine

Routine: BPSOSQA


Information

BPSOSQA ;BHAM ISC/FCS/DRS/DLF - ECME background, Part 1 ;06/02/2004

Source Information

Source file <BPSOSQA.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
E Claims Management Engine 4 (LOG,LOGARRAY)^BPSOSL  (ERROR,SETSTAT)^BPSOSU  ($$RXAPI1,$$RXSUBF1)^BPSUTIL1  $$COB59^BPSUTIL2  
Kernel 1 ^%ZTLOAD  
VA FileMan 1 ^%DT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 5

Package Total Caller Graph
E Claims Management Engine 5 BPSNCPD2  BPSOSIZ  BPSOSQ2  BPSOSQ4  BPSOSRB  

Entry Points

Name Comments DBIA/ICR reference
ONE59(IEN59) ;EP - from BPSOSIZ
; Process this one IEN59
END ; Common exit point
LOG59(IEN59) ; Log the IEN59 array
TASK ;EP - from BPSOSQ2,BPSOSQ4,BPSOSRB
TASKAT(ZTDTH) ;EP - from BPSOSQ4 (requeue if insurer is sleeping)

External References

Name Field # of Occurrence
^%DT TASK+1
^%ZTLOAD TASKAT+3
LOG^BPSOSL ONE59+9, END+5, END+8
LOGARRAY^BPSOSL LOG59+3
ERROR^BPSOSU ONE59+12, ONE59+15, ONE59+24, ONE59+27, ONE59+30, ONE59+33
SETSTAT^BPSOSU ONE59+37
$$RXAPI1^BPSUTIL1 ONE59+20
$$RXSUBF1^BPSUTIL1 ONE59+21
$$COB59^BPSUTIL2 END+4

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^BPST - [#9002313.59] ONE59+5, ONE59+24, ONE59+33, LOG59+2
^BPST("AD" END+12

Label References

Name Line Occurrences
END ONE59+12, ONE59+15, ONE59+24, ONE59+27, ONE59+30, ONE59+33
LOG59 END+9
TASK END+12
TASKAT TASK+2

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
%DT TASK+1~*
A LOG59+1~, LOG59+2*
BPSCOB END+3~, END+4*, END+5
ERRMSG ONE59+4~, ONE59+14*, ONE59+15, ONE59+18*, ONE59+19*, ONE59+20*, ONE59+21*
ERRNO ONE59+4~, ONE59+14*, ONE59+15, ONE59+18*, ONE59+19*, ONE59+20*, ONE59+21*
IEN59 ONE59~, ONE59+5, ONE59+9, ONE59+12, ONE59+15, ONE59+24, ONE59+27, ONE59+30, ONE59+33, ONE59+37
END+4, END+5, END+8, END+9, LOG59~, LOG59+2, LOG59+3
REQTYPE ONE59+4~, ONE59+5*, ONE59+12, ONE59+15
RTN ONE59+4~, ONE59+5*, ONE59+12, ONE59+15, ONE59+24, ONE59+27, ONE59+30, ONE59+33
RX ONE59+16~, ONE59+17*, ONE59+18, ONE59+20, ONE59+21
RXR ONE59+16~, ONE59+17*, ONE59+19, ONE59+21
U ONE59+5, ONE59+17, ONE59+24, ONE59+27, ONE59+30
X TASK+1~*
X1 ONE59+4~, ONE59+5*, ONE59+17, ONE59+27, ONE59+30
Y TASK+1~, TASK+2
ZTDTH TASKAT~
ZTIO TASKAT+1~, TASKAT+2*
ZTRTN TASKAT+1~, TASKAT+2*

Marked Items

Name Field # of Occurrence
$T( ONE59+5, ONE59+9, END+5, END+8
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ables |  Marked Items  | All